Many hotels in New Jersey provide a range of child services designed to cater to families traveling with children. Common offerings include babysitting services, where trained childcare professionals are available to watch over children in the hotel room or designated areas. Additionally, some hotels might offer kids’ clubs, where children can engage in supervised activities, crafts, and games, allowing parents some time to relax. Other amenities might include cribs, high chairs, and children's menus in on-site dining options, as well as family-friendly entertainment and recreational facilities.


Hotels prioritize the safety of children in their babysitting services by carefully vetting their childcare staff. This process often includes background checks, training in child CPR and first aid, and experience in working with children. Many hotels also provide guidelines for sitters to follow, which may include maintaining a secure environment, ensuring that all areas used by children are safe, and conducting regular checks to monitor the wellbeing of the children in their care. Furthermore, some hotels encourage parents to meet babysitters prior to leaving their children in their care, fostering trust and security.


The age requirements for hotel babysitting services can vary by hotel, but typically, these services are available for children from infancy through their early teenage years. Many hotels can accommodate infants and toddlers, while others may have preferences for the minimum age they can babysit. It is advisable for parents to check with the hotel in advance about their specific age policies and to find out what age-appropriate activities and supports are available for different children.

Families looking for hotels with suitable child care services in New Jersey can start by conducting online research on hotel websites where they can learn about specific amenities offered. Additionally, reading reviews from other families can provide insight into the quality of the services. Another effective approach is to utilize travel forums and social media groups where parents share their experiences and recommendations. Finally, contacting hotels directly can clarify what specific services are available, allowing families to make informed choices based on their unique needs.
